2010-09-23 9 views

risposta

14

SI!

Con un impressionante cosa chiamata selettori di attributo:

input[type="text"] { width: 200px; } 

basta cambiare che text lì e siete pronti per partire!

Ma notare che queste non funzionano su IE6, così si potrebbe desiderare di dare un'occhiata al dean.edwards.name IE7.js :)

0

Non ho mai visto questo fatto (e ho provato personalmente). Credo che dovresti avere qualche JavaScript/jQuery eseguito sul rendering della pagina per manipolare le classi di oggetti in base agli attributi degli elementi.

4

Per fare ciò è possibile utilizzare input[type=text]. Tuttavia, i vecchi browser potrebbero non supportarlo.

3

Sì, è possibile

esempio

input[type="text"]{ 
/*do something*/ 
} 

e più

input[type="text"] { 
font:bold 10px/12px verdana,arial,serif; 
padding:3px; 
} 
input[type="button"],input[type="submit"] { 
/* you know what to do */ 
} 
5

È possibile utilizzare il selettore di attributo, come questo

input[type=text] { ... } 

Tuttavia, questo non è supportato in tutti i browser. La cosa più sicura è quella di utilizzare una classe

2

si può fare di input [type = "text"]

1

È possibile utilizzare

input[type="What ever the type you want to style specifically"] 
Problemi correlati